Pop star Anastacia is back in Australia after ten years, touring to mark the 25th anniversary of her first successful album, ‘Not That Kind’.

The iconic performer is bringing her show to Melbourne, Sydney, and Brisbane this month, reminding everyone why she’s always been a beloved music superstar.

Her first Australian show will be at Melbourne’s Forum on September 24.

The singer, known for her hit “I’m Outta Love”, will perform two concerts in Sydney. She’ll be at the Rooty Hill Coliseum on September 26th, and then at the Enmore Theatre on September 27th.

Anastacia will finish her Australian tour with a final performance at Eaton’s Hill Hotel in Brisbane on September 29th.

Anastacia last toured Australia in 2015 as part of her Resurrection Tour. 

When “Not That Kind” came out in 2000, it quickly became popular in Australia, climbing to number 2 on the ARIA album chart.

It was also a hit on the ARIA Dance Album chart, reaching number one. 

The album ‘Not That Kind’ spawned several popular singles, such as the title track, alongside hits like ‘I’m Outta Love,’ ‘Cowboys and Kisses,’ and ‘Made For Lovin’ You’.

After becoming a household name, Anastacia took a lower profile in recent years.

It was later revealed that the performer had been struggling with several health problems, which made it very difficult for her to continue working internationally over time.

The pop star courageously fought Crohn’s disease, a heart condition and two bouts of breast cancer.

The singer of “Sick And Tired” was diagnosed with Crohn’s disease at age 13. This condition is a long-term illness that causes inflammation in the digestive system and can lead to ongoing, serious health problems.

In 2003, she received a breast cancer diagnosis, and shortly after, was also diagnosed with supraventricular tachycardia, a condition that causes an irregular and fast heartbeat.

In 2013, after receiving a second breast cancer diagnosis, Anastacia chose to have a double mastectomy right away.

Anastacia, a popular singer in Australia, gained significant attention in 2021 by winning the reality TV show, The Masked Singer Australia.

Anastacia’s eighth studio album, “Our Song,” came out in 2023 and quickly became a chart-topper in both Germany and the United Kingdom.
